Location: Riyadh,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ia Job ID: R0072962 Date Posted: 2025-01-20 Company Name: HITACHI ENERGY LTD Profession (Job Category): Engineering & Science Job Schedule: Full time Remote: No Job Description: You as a Customers Technical Support Manager will be part of Hitachi Energy business based in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. Leading customer technical support activities during tendering, execution and after sales during warranty in full coordination with the internal stakeholders (e.g. operation sales manager, supplying units, tendering manager, Market manager and FES). Your responsibilities

  • Creating, implementing, monitoring and reviewing customer technical support strategy with respect to all Transformers supply into Saudi during sales, execution & after sales.
  • The key targets are during sales, during execution and after sales.
  • Supporting tendering activities as needed during technical bid preparation in coordination with tendering manager, attending site visits or site observations if requested by supplying units during tendering stage (spare transformers tenders) and pre-bid and post-bid technical clarifications clearance as needed in coordination with Tendering Manager and supplying units.
  • Support all technical discussions related to base design approval in coordination with Local PM and supplying units and oversee and create the plans related to site supervision activities in coordination with local PM, supplying unit’s supervisors or with TRES or third-party service as needed.
  • Recording NCRs or CCRP and work hand-in-hand with local PM and supplying units on the technical resolution.
  • Promoting new technology and digital offerings.
  • Attending customer warranty notifications and perform 1st inspections on behalf of supplying units, creating the CCRP and support the RCA review in coordination with the quality team and hand over the resolution implementation to PM/operation sales to take over.
  • Creating new leads from site observations and assign them to Local Service as well as promote digital solutions when applicable.
  • Abiding by all HSE rules as license to operate especially during site activities and frequent travelling activities.
  • Ensuring support to the Sales organizations during technical meetings, product presentations and negotiations with customers and provide technical support and clarification as needed.
  • Living Hitachi Energy’s core values of saf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.
Your background
  • A bachelor’s degree in a relevant industry is required.
  • Minimum 10 years of required experience in the field of power transformers service, design, erection, testing and commissioning.
  • Minimum 5 years in a managerial role associated with the Power Transformers field.
  • Ability to analyze Power Transformers failures and write up comprehensive root cause analysis.
  • Team-building ability & setup plans for site works associated with power transformers activities (e.g., erection, testing and commissioning).
  • Experienced in local specifications of power transformers in both UT and Industry.
  • Additional experience in Transformers tendering or Project Management or Product Marketing is a plus.
  • Proficiency in both spoken & written English language is required.
